Xinzhou, once known as Xiurong, is a city with deep historical roots in Shanxi Province, China. It serves as a prefecture-level city and is strategically positioned, bordering Hebei to the east, Shaanxi to the west, and Inner Mongolia to the northwest. With a population of over 2.6 million as of 2022, Xinzhou offers a blend of cultural heritage and regional importance. Be prepared for cold winters and hot summers typical of northern China.
Spring is mild and perfect for exploring the city's historical sites.
Summers can be hot, but it's a great time for cultural festivals.
Autumn offers pleasant weather and fewer tourists, ideal for sightseeing.
Winters are cold, so dress warmly if visiting during this season.
